Comparison of anti- inflammatory activity of four different molecular fractions of cod protein hydrolytic peptides

  • Effects of four different molecular fractions of cod protein hydrolytic peptides( CPHP) on LPS- induced release of inflammatory cytokines were compared. CPHP was a whole mixture of cod protein hydrolytic peptides hydrolyzed by complex protease. The peptides were further fractionated by ultrafiltration into three fractions of CPHP1( > 5000 u),CPHP2( < 3000 u) and CPHP3( 3000 ~ 5000 u). Griess assay and ELISA kits were used to measure the levels of NO and inflammatory cytokines( TNF-α,IL-1β and IL-6),respectively. The results showed that the all CPHP fractions protected RAW264.7 cells from LPS( 500 μg / m L) induced cell growth inhibition,in a dose dependent manner,and protective effects of CPHP and CPHP1 were higher than that of CPHP2 and CPHP3. All CPHP fractions inhibited release of NO,IL-1β,IL-6 and TNF-α from RAW264.7 cells induced by LPS( 1 μg / m L),in a dose dependent manner.The inhibitory effects of CPHP and CPHP1 were higher than that of CPHP2 and CPHP3.In conclusion,all four fractions of CPHP had protective effect against LPS induced cell growth inhibition and release of inflammatory cytokines.The CPHP and CPHP1 had higher activity than that of CPHP2 and CPHP3.
